2006 Code of Virginia § 22.1-81 - Annual report

22.1-81. Annual report.

Unless for good cause shown an extension of time not to exceed fifteen daysis granted by the Superintendent of Public Instruction, each school board,with the assistance of the division superintendent, shall, on or beforeSeptember 15 of each year, make a report covering the work of the schools forthe year ending the preceding June 30 to the Board of Education on formssupplied by the Superintendent of Public Instruction.

(Code 1950, 22-54; 1980, c. 559; 1987, c. 205; 1999, cc. 191, 492.)
